Understanding the Mechanics of Ascent and Risk

The core gameplay of the aviator game centers around observing the airplane's trajectory. At the beginning of each round, the plane starts at a low altitude, and a multiplier begins to increase. The longer the plane stays airborne, the higher the multiplier climbs. Players set their desired cash-out point either automatically before the round begins or manually by clicking the ‘Cash Out’ button during the flight. The goal is to cash out before the plane ‘crashes’ – abruptly disappears from the screen. If successful, the player receives their initial bet multiplied by the cash-out multiplier. However, if the plane crashes before the player cashes out, they lose their entire stake. This core loop is deceptively simple, but mastering it requires understanding the probabilities and developing a sound risk management strategy.

A key aspect to consider is the Random Number Generator (RNG) that dictates when the plane will crash. These generators are sophisticated algorithms designed to produce unpredictable outcomes, ensuring fairness. While it's impossible to predict exactly when the plane will crash, understanding the statistical probabilities can help players make informed decisions. For example, the plane is more likely to crash at higher multipliers, but the rewards are correspondingly greater. Players must weigh the risk of losing their stake against the potential for a substantial payout. Many players employ strategies based on observing patterns in previous rounds, though it’s important to remember each round is independent, and past results do not guarantee future outcomes.

The Role of the RNG and Fairness

The integrity of any online casino game hinges on the fairness of its underlying RNG. Reputable aviator game providers utilize certified RNGs that are regularly audited by independent testing agencies. These audits verify that the RNG produces truly random results, preventing manipulation or bias. Players should always ensure they are playing at casinos that partner with licensed and reputable game providers. Transparency is crucial; information about the RNG and the game’s payout percentage (Return to Player or RTP) should be readily available. The RTP represents the average percentage of wagered money that is returned to players over time, and a hig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able game for players. Understanding these technical aspects can instill confidence in the game’s fairness and enhance the overall playing experience.

Looking for certifications from organizations like eCOGRA or iTech Labs provides an extra layer of assurance. These independent bodies conduct rigorous testing to ensure games meet industry standards for fairness and randomness. Furthermore, leading platforms often employ provably fair systems allowing players to verify the integrity of each game round themselves. This level of transparency further assures players that results aren’t predetermined.

The Martingale and Anti-Martingale Systems

In the realm of betting strategies, the Martingale and Anti-Martingale systems are often discussed in relation to the aviator game. The Martingale system invol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recouping past losses and securing a small profit. While seemingly logical, this strategy can quickly deplete your bankroll if you experience a prolonged losing streak. The Anti-Martingale system, conversely, involves increasing your bet after each win, capitalizing on winning streaks. This approach allows for potentially larger profits but can also lead to rapid losses if your luck turns. Both systems require careful bankroll management and an understanding of their inherent risks.

It's important to remember that neither the Martingale nor the Anti-Martingale system guarantees success. They are merely betting strategies that can be used to manage your risk and potentially increase your profits. The aviator game remains a game of chance, and no strategy can eliminate the element of luck. Responsible gambling practices, including setting limits and avoiding chasing losses, are crucial regardless of the strategy you choose.

Psychological Aspects of Playing the Aviator Game

The aviator game isn’t purely mathematical; it's deeply intertwined with human psychology. The thrill of watching the plane ascend and the anticipation of a potential payout trigger dopamine release in the brain, creating a highly addictive experience. This can lead to impulsive decision-making, such as chasing losses or betting beyond your means. Understanding these psychological factors is essential for maintaining control and avoiding problem gambling. Players often fall victim to the ‘gambler’s fallacy’ – the belief that past outcomes influence future events, despite the independence of each round.

The fear of missing out (FOMO) also plays a significant role. Watching others cash out at high multipliers can create a strong urge to continue playing, even when faced with increasing risk. It’s vital to remain rational and resist the temptation to chase unrealistic expectations. Mindfulness and self-awareness are key: recognize when you’re becoming emotionally invested and take breaks if needed. Treating the game as entertainment, rather than a source of income, can help mitigate the psychological risks.
